The representations of Roman houses all show them with tiled roofs. This makes sense because tiles would allow the rain water to drain off quickly and if one were damaged, it would be simpler to replace a single tile than an entire roof.

The Romans used a variety of materials. They invented cement so that was used in most buildings. I was in an ancient Roman villa in Sicily that was constructed with marble, adobe, cement, and had mosaic flooring. It was 65 rooms and every floor/room had mosaics on them.

How much did houses cost in ancient Rome?

The prices for Roman villas in ancient times varied greatly. Small villas cost under 200,000 Denarii and large ornate villas could cost over 800,000 Denarii.

What is the heating system in a roman villa?

A hypocaust was an underfloor heating system found in many ancient Roman villas. Hot air from a furnace heated the spaces under the floor and around walls.
